Like Babies: One Millennial's Response to Safe Spaces on U.S. College Campuses

Abstract
As the political climate in the United States continues to polarize its residents, colleges and universities find themselves creating safe spaces for their students to explore new ideas in order to feel free from physical or emotional harm during this process. In this conceptual essay, I argue safe spaces are necessary, deemed "21st century incubators," as the invent of social media and immediate, instantaneous Internet communications have rendered the U.S. sociopolitical environment a dangerous, and potentially unsafe, one.
